    Just moved my kid into Blinn-- was recommend by his roommate to check out Nathan's. It's not bad-- it's passable bbq, especially the chicken ribs and sides. Brisket was another story, dry and really chewy. Chicken and ribs had great smoke on them and tasted good. Two plates ran around 43 with drinks, it's pricey but all things bbq are pricey now. If we are back at Blinn I would be ok with coming back here-- connected to shell station so this ironically fits the version of Texas bbq. Texans this isn't franklins or la barbecue, for familiarity I'd say similar to Rudy's except for the brisket. Nice place to sit inside and has Pepsi product for fountain drinks. Other reviews mentioned bad service, I had nothing of the sort quite the opposite, pit guys were friendly and patient with my son who has autism.
